The Importance Of Digital Literacy Skills In Today’s World

In this digital age, where technology plays a significant role in our daily lives, having digital literacy skills is crucial. Digital literacy refers to the ability to access, evaluate, and use information from various digital sources effectively. These skills are essential for navigating the internet, using social media, and engaging with digital devices. In this article, we will explore the importance of digital literacy skills in today’s world and why it is necessary for both personal and professional growth.

One of the primary reasons why digital literacy skills are essential is the ever-evolving nature of technology. With new digital tools and platforms being introduced constantly, it is vital to be able to adapt and learn how to use them efficiently. From social media to online banking, having digital literacy skills can make a significant difference in how you interact with technology. Being digitally literate allows individuals to stay current with the latest trends and advancements in technology, giving them a competitive edge in the digital landscape.

Moreover, digital literacy skills are essential for academic and professional success. In the classroom, students are often required to conduct research, write papers, and create presentations using digital tools. Without the necessary digital literacy skills, students may struggle to find credible sources, communicate their ideas effectively, and present their work in a professional manner. Likewise, in the workplace, employees are expected to be proficient in using various digital tools and platforms to perform their job responsibilities efficiently. From email communication to data analysis, digital literacy skills are crucial for career advancement and success.

Furthermore, digital literacy skills play a vital role in promoting critical thinking and problem-solving abilities. In the digital world, individuals are bombarded with information from a variety of sources, making it essential to evaluate the credibility and reliability of the content they encounter. By developing digital literacy skills, individuals can learn to discern between fact and fiction, identify bias in information, and make informed decisions based on evidence. These critical thinking skills are valuable not only in the digital realm but also in everyday life, helping individuals navigate complex situations and make sound judgments.

Another reason why digital literacy skills are necessary is their impact on social interactions and relationships. With the rise of social media and online communication platforms, it has become easier than ever to connect with others and share information. However, without proper digital literacy skills, individuals may struggle to protect their privacy, filter out unwanted content, and engage in meaningful conversations online. By developing digital literacy skills, individuals can learn how to maintain a positive digital footprint, protect their personal information, and engage in respectful and meaningful interactions with others.

In addition to personal and professional growth, digital literacy skills also contribute to digital citizenship. Digital citizenship refers to the responsible and ethical use of technology, including respecting others’ privacy, avoiding cyberbullying, and promoting digital security. By developing digital literacy skills, individuals can become informed and responsible digital citizens, contributing to a safe and supportive online community. In an age where cyber threats and online misinformation are prevalent, digital literacy skills are essential for protecting oneself and others in the digital world.

In conclusion, digital literacy skills are vital for navigating the complexities of the digital age. From accessing information to communicating with others online, these skills are essential for personal, academic, and professional growth. By developing digital literacy skills, individuals can stay current with technology trends, enhance their critical thinking abilities, and become responsible digital citizens. In today’s world, where technology plays a significant role in our lives, having digital literacy skills is not just beneficial but necessary for success.
